How To Reach Vieux Port

Welcome to Vieux Port, Marseille, France

Reaching Vieux Port in Marseille, France, is convenient, as this historic port is situated in the heart of the city and is well-connected through various modes of transportation. Here's how you can reach this iconic destination:

By Air

Marseille Provence Airport (MRS) is the nearest international airport to Vieux Port. It is located approximately 25 kilometers northwest of the city. Upon arriving, you can choose between the following options to reach Vieux Port:

  • Shuttle Service: There is a shuttle service that runs every 15-20 minutes from the airport to Marseille Saint Charles Train Station.
  • Taxi: Taxis are available at the airport and can take you directly to Vieux Port. The journey typically takes around 30 minutes, depending on traffic.
  • Car Rentals: Various car rental agencies are present at the airport if you prefer to drive to the port yourself.

By Train

Marseille Saint Charles Train Station is the main rail hub for the city. From here you have multiple options:

  • Metro: Take the M1 metro line directly from Saint Charles Station to Vieux Port Station.
  • Walking: The station is about a 20-minute walk from the Vieux Port.
  • Taxi: Taxis are readily available outside the station.

By Car

If you are driving to Vieux Port:

  • Use major highways and roads such as the A7 and A55, which lead into Marseille.
  • Follow signs directing you to the city center and Vieux Port.
  • Parking can be found in designated areas, as the port itself is largely pedestrianized.

By Bus

Marseille has a comprehensive bus system that connects to various parts of the city:

  • Multiple bus routes stop near Vieux Port, including numbers 49, 60, 82, and 82S.

By Bicycle

Marseille has a public bicycle rental system called Le vélo:

  • There are many stations throughout Marseille where you can pick up and drop off bicycles.
  • Bicycle paths are available that lead to Vieux Port.

Note: Vieux Port is a bustling area with limited vehicle access in certain parts, making walking and cycling pleasant options for exploring the area.
